The Hidden Costs of Complacency: Beyond Just Losing Data

When we discuss CRM data vulnerability, it’s often framed solely as a “backup” problem. But the implications extend far beyond simply losing a few contact records. Consider the high-value employees whose productivity hinges on accurate, accessible data. Imagine your sales team, poised to close a critical deal, suddenly facing corrupted prospect histories or missing interaction logs. Or your marketing department unable to segment audiences effectively because customer preferences have vanished. This isn’t just an inconvenience; it’s a direct assault on the efficiency and effectiveness that high-growth businesses meticulously cultivate.

The true cost manifests in several ways:

  • **Operational Paralysis:** Key processes, from lead nurturing to customer support, grind to a halt when the underlying data is unreliable or inaccessible.
  • **Revenue Erosion:** Sales cycles lengthen, conversion rates drop, and customer churn increases when teams can’t provide personalized, informed service.
  • **Reputational Damage:** Clients expect continuity and accuracy. Data loss or breaches erode trust, a cornerstone for any B2B relationship.
  • **Compliance Risks:** Depending on your industry, data integrity isn’t just good practice—it’s a regulatory mandate, and failures can lead to hefty fines.
  • **Stifled Scalability:** Growth requires predictable, repeatable processes. If your core data foundation is shaky, scaling up simply magnifies existing vulnerabilities. You’re not just growing; you’re growing on quicksand.

Why Traditional Backups Fall Short for High-Growth Firms

Many businesses assume their CRM provider has robust backup solutions, and to an extent, they do. However, these often protect against catastrophic system failures on the provider’s end, not necessarily against common internal mistakes. An accidentally deleted record, an overwritten field, or a misconfigured automation can lead to data loss that the CRM’s native recovery might not easily address without significant downtime or data rollback, impacting everything since the last snapshot. This is a critical distinction.

For high-growth companies pushing the boundaries with integrations and complex workflows, the risk is compounded. Every integration point—whether it’s an email marketing platform, an accounting system, or an HR tool—creates another vector for potential data inconsistencies or unintended modifications if not managed with an overarching strategy. Without a comprehensive, strategic approach, your CRM, instead of being a single source of truth, becomes a fragmented and vulnerable data hub.
